Professional Drain Unblocking Across All Dundee Neighbourhoods

Dundee is Scotland’s fourth-largest city, with a population of over 148,000 and a diverse mix of housing stock — from Victorian tenements in Stobswell and Hilltown to modern developments at the Waterfront, from sandstone terraces in the West End to suburban semis in Broughty Ferry and Barnhill. Each type of property presents its own drainage challenges, and understanding these differences is what sets our Dundee drain unblocking service apart from national chains.

Older Dundee tenements — particularly those built before 1919 in areas like Blackness, Lochee, and the Hilltown — often share communal drain stacks and have original clay or cast-iron pipework that’s now over 100 years old. These pipes are vulnerable to cracking, root ingress from mature street trees, and blockages caused by decades of accumulated scale and debris. Our engineers have extensive experience working on these older Dundee systems and understand the access challenges that tenement living presents — from locked back courts to shared stairwells.

In contrast, Dundee’s newer developments — including the Waterfront apartments, the housing estates of Fintry and Whitfield, and the suburban expansion around Downfield — typically have modern PVC pipework but face different issues. Construction debris left in drains, poor original installation, and the sheer volume of usage in multi-occupancy buildings can all lead to blocked drains in Dundee that need professional attention. We’re equally comfortable working on modern systems and carry the full range of equipment needed to diagnose and clear blockages in any type of Dundee property.

Dundee’s coastal location also means that properties in Broughty Ferry, Monifieth, and along the Riverside face additional drainage challenges — including tidal groundwater pressure on older drains, sand and silt ingress in coastal gullies, and storm-related flooding during the wetter months. Our outdoor drain and gully clearing service is particularly valuable for these Dundee coastal communities, where external drainage needs to cope with both rainfall and tidal water tables.

Common Drainage Problems We See Across Dundee

Every city has its own characteristic drainage issues, and Dundee is no exception. Here are the patterns we’ve identified from thousands of drain unblocking Dundee call-outs.

Tenement Drain Stack Blockages

Dundee’s tenements — particularly in Lochee, Hilltown, Stobswell, and Blackness — share vertical drain stacks that serve multiple flats. When one flat flushes inappropriate items, the entire stack can become blocked, affecting every resident above and below. These blocked drains in Dundee tenements often require access through multiple properties and specialist equipment to clear the shared pipework. Our engineers are experienced in navigating the access challenges that tenement living presents and can coordinate with factors and letting agents where needed.

Fat and Grease in Commercial Kitchen Drains

Dundee has a thriving food scene — from the restaurants of the Waterfront and City Centre to the cafes of Broughty Ferry and the takeaways of Lochee Road. Commercial kitchens produce large volumes of fat, oil, and grease that, if not properly disposed of, quickly create severe blocked drains. We provide regular commercial drain maintenance for Dundee businesses, using high-pressure jetting to clear grease traps and kitchen waste pipes before they cause shutdowns.

Root Ingress in Older Dundee Properties

The mature street trees that line Dundee’s Victorian and Edwardian suburbs — particularly in the West End, Broughty Ferry, and around Baxter Park — have extensive root systems that seek out the moisture and nutrients in drain pipes. Properties with original clay pipework are especially vulnerable. We use CCTV drain surveys to locate root ingress precisely and remove roots with specialist cutting equipment before they cause pipe collapse.

Student Accommodation Drainage Issues

With two universities — the University of Dundee and Abertay University — Dundee has a large student population concentrated in the West End, City Centre, and around the campuses. Student accommodation, whether halls of residence or private HMO flats, experiences high-volume usage and, often, a lack of awareness about what should and shouldn’t go down drains. Wet wipes, sanitary products, and cooking fat are particularly common in blocked drains in Dundee student properties. We work with landlords and letting agents to provide responsive, discreet drain unblocking whenever it’s needed.

Coastal and Riverside Drainage Challenges

Properties in Broughty Ferry, Monifieth, Barnhill, and along Riverside Drive face additional drainage pressures from Dundee’s coastal and estuarine location. High tides can slow the discharge of surface water drains, while sand and silt accumulate in coastal gullies during storms. During Dundee’s wetter months — typically October through February — we see a significant increase in blocked outdoor drains in these areas. Our outdoor drain clearing service is essential for these properties.

Construction Debris in New-Build Drains

Dundee’s ongoing regeneration — including the Waterfront development and new housing across the city — means that many properties have relatively new drainage systems. Unfortunately, construction debris such as cement, plaster, and rubble sometimes finds its way into pipework during the building process, creating blocked drains that may not become apparent until months after completion. Our CCTV drain surveys can identify these issues quickly, often saving homeowners from expensive exploratory excavation.

What causes most blocked drains in Dundee properties?

The most common causes of blocked drains we see in Dundee are: fat, oil, and grease build-up in kitchen drains (particularly in tenement buildings and shared pipework in areas like Lochee and Hilltown), wet wipes and sanitary products in toilets, tree root ingress in older properties in areas like Broughty Ferry and the West End, hair and soap scum in shower drains, and outdoor gully blockages from leaves and silt — especially during autumn and after heavy rain.
